A BOFE representative will review the report to determine whether to investigate the employer. If BOFE starts an investigation, it may inspect the worksite, issue citations for violations, work with the employer to correct the problem, and collect any unpaid wages owed to workers.

Learn how labor relations software can help employers manage this process. Labor board investigations typically last at least a few months, but there's no set timeline and each case is unique. In more complex cases, the process could potentially play out across several years.

We are able to resolve most cases administratively. If appropriate, the Department of Labor may litigate and/or recommend criminal prosecution. Employers who have willfully violated the law may be subject to criminal penalties, including fines and imprisonment.
